Persian Blue
General Information about Persian Blue
The color #0627C4, also known as Persian Blue, is a deep and vibrant shade of blue that belongs to the blue color family. It is characterized by its strong, saturated hue, evoking feelings of depth and sophistication. In the RGB color model, #0627C4 is composed of 2.4% red, 15.3% green, and 76.9% blue. This color is often associated with qualities such as trust, loyalty, wisdom, confidence, intelligence, faith, truth, and heaven. Persian Blue has been used throughout history in various art forms, including paintings, textiles, and ceramics, reflecting its cultural significance. The hex code #0627C4 is a specific representation of this unique shade of blue, allowing for precise color reproduction in digital media and design.
The hex color #0627C4, a deep Persian Blue, presents significant accessibility challenges, especially in web design. Its low luminance value means that text rendered in this color requires very light foreground colors to achieve sufficient contrast for readability. According to WCAG guidelines, a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 is recommended for normal text and 3:1 for large text. Using #0627C4 for text or interactive elements necessitates careful selection of contrasting colors to ensure that users with visual impairments, including those with low vision or color blindness, can perceive the content effectively. Designers should use tools to verify contrast ratios and consider providing alternative color schemes to accommodate different user preferences and needs. Furthermore, relying solely on color to convey information should be avoided; supplementary cues like text labels or icons are crucial to ensure inclusivity.

Web Design for Trust and Security
Persian Blue is a color that can be used in web design to create a sense of trust and security. This is useful in designing websites and applications for financial institutions, healthcare providers, and government agencies. The deep blue hue can be applied to primary calls-to-action, headers, and key informational elements to establish credibility and guide users through important processes. Furthermore, the color can be used to accentuate the user experience and inspire a feeling of confidence. However, using the color requires very light contrasting colors to be accessible.
Fashion Accent Color
In the realm of fashion, Persian Blue can be used as an accent color in clothing and accessories. A silk scarf, a statement handbag, or a pair of designer shoes in this hue can add a pop of color to a neutral outfit. The color provides a sense of sophistication and elegance, making it suitable for formal wear and high-end fashion designs. Moreover, incorporating #0627C4 into jewelry, such as sapphire earrings or a lapis lazuli necklace, can complement the aesthetic of the design.
Interior Design Accent
In interior design, Persian Blue can be used as a statement color to add a touch of sophistication and depth to a space. It can be applied to accent walls, furniture upholstery, or decorative accessories like throw pillows and vases. The color works well in living rooms, bedrooms, or studies, creating an atmosphere of calmness and elegance. Pairing #0627C4 with neutral colors like beige, gray, or white can balance the intensity of the blue and create a harmonious color palette.
